NOVATEK’s Board of Directors approve agenda for Annual General Meeting of Shareholders

Moscow, 12 March 2015. OAO NOVATEK (the “Company”) today announced the results of its Board of Directors (the “Board”) meeting in preparation for the Company’s upcoming Annual General Meeting of Shareholders (“AGM”).

The Board has approved the following agenda for the Company’s AGM:

1.        To approve the Company’s Russian statutory accounts and annual report for the year ended 31 December 2014, and the allocation of profit and loss, including approval of the final dividend, payable to shareholders based on 2014 results;

2.        Election of members of the Board of Directors of OAO NOVATEK;

3.        Election of members of the Revision Commission of OAO NOVATEK;

4.        To appoint the Company’s auditor for 2015;

5.        To approve the revised version of the Regulations on Remuneration and Compensation Payable to Members of Board of Directors of OAO NOVATEK’s;

6.        To approve the remuneration to members of OAO NOVATEK’s Board of Directors;

7.        To approve the remuneration to members of OAO NOVATEK’s Revision Commission;

The Company’s AGM will take place on 24 April 2015. Shareholders at the close of business on the 23 March 2015 will be entitled to participate in the Company’s AGM. The recommended date for compiling the list of shareholders entitled to receive dividends is 5 May 2015.

The Board also approved amendments to the Company’s Regulations on Risk Management and Internal Control Systems in order to enhance efficiency and independence of the internal audit function and bring the Regulations into compliance with the new listing rules of Moscow Stock Exchange.


PAO NOVATEK is one of the largest independent natural gas producers in Russia, and in 2017, entered the global LNG market by successfully launching the Yamal LNG project. Founded in 1994, the Company is engaged in the exploration, production, processing and marketing of natural gas and liquid hydrocarbons. Upstream activities of the Company’s subsidiaries and joint ventures are concentrated mainly in the prolific Yamal-Nenets Autonomous Area, which is the world’s largest natural gas producing area and accounts for approximately 80% of Russia’s natural gas production and approximately 15% of the world’s gas production. NOVATEK is a public joint stock company established under the laws of the Russian Federation.
